Working at Height on National Highways Toolbox Talk: Preventing Falls and Ensuring Safe Operations

The Working at Height on National Highways Toolbox Talk provides essential guidance for managing work at height during highways operations. Developed in line with Raising the Bar 16 (RTB16), this document aligns with UK legislation such as the Work at Height Regulations 2005 and HSE guidance to help businesses implement safe, compliant working practices and reduce the risk of falls from height, a leading cause of workplace fatalities in the construction and highways sectors.

Working at height in highways environments presents significant risks, particularly when accessing overhead structures, gantries, bridges, or temporary traffic management installations. This toolbox talk covers the key principles of height safety, including the hierarchy of control measures:

  • Avoiding work at height where possible
  • Using collective protection measures like guardrails and scaffolding
  • Implementing personal fall protection equipment (PFPE) when other measures are impractical

The document highlights practical safety practices such as pre-work risk assessments, equipment inspections, and competency checks for workers using access equipment like mobile elevated work platforms (MEWPs) and temporary scaffolding structures. It also stresses the importance of safe access and egress procedures, ensuring operatives are trained to recognise hazards like unprotected edges, fragile surfaces, and adverse weather conditions that increase the risk of falls.

In line with Raising the Bar 16, the toolbox talk also reinforces the importance of clear communication and site-specific work at height plans. Workers are encouraged to report unsafe practices immediately and to use designated anchor points and safety systems correctly.
